Levels of benzene, a cancer-causing chemical, reached new highs in the troubled community of Channelview. Regulators never told residents. - Public Health Watch

Summary by Public Health Watch
For nearly 20 years, the Texas Commission on Environmental Quality (TCEQ) has been tracking high levels of benzene outside K-Solv, a barge cleaning and chemical distribution company located in southeastern Channelview, Texas.
